Scotland’s Solway Firth is the UK’s first Landscape Connections project

“SCAMP is the perfect project to kick-start our UK-wide £150 million Landscape Connections initiative… our ambitions to support nature recovery on a vast scale.”

Eilish McGuinness, Chief Executive, The National Lottery Heritage Fund 

“Led by Dumfries and Galloway Council, this long term, large-scale project is part of our 10-year strategic initiative supporting the UK’s world-class landscapes.

Barbara and Gabby co-designed the public engagement for SCAMP, meeting with activists and passionate lovers of nature across Dumfries & Galloway to explore what caring for the coastal environment might mean and identify priorities.
